What is the history of Goodfield State Bank?

Written by Editorial Team | Last Updated: August 2026

Goodfield State Bank has a rich history rooted in rural community banking within Illinois, having been established to provide dependable financial services, agricultural operating loans, and personal banking to local farm families and small businesses. Operating under traditional relationship banking principles, the institution navigated numerous agricultural cycles, economic recessions, and banking industry modernizations by maintaining conservative underwriting practices and strong capital reserves. Through generations of local leadership, the bank preserved its independent community focus while expanding its operational footprint and modern financial service offerings across Woodford County and surrounding regional communities.
